/* CSS Document writed by Vincenzo Trapani for grafill srl. */
/*24.09.09*/

.formBlue{ width:155px; height:16px; border:1px solid #6699CC;font-family:Arial, Helvetica, sans-serif; color:#1E5E8F; font-size:12px;  padding-top:2px;padding-left:2px; margin-right:10px}
.formBlueNoLeft{ width:155px; height:16px; border:1px solid #6699CC; border-right:0px;font-family:Arial, Helvetica, sans-serif; color:#1E5E8F; font-size:12px;  padding-top:2px;padding-left:2px;}
.formBlueButton{ background:url(../img/buttonBg.jpg); height:16px; border:1px solid #6699CC; width:50px; margin-left:5px}
.formBlueSelectCerca{  height:20px; width:auto; border:1px solid #6699CC;}
.formBlueBig{  height:30px; width:500px; border:2px solid #77D5F7;}
.formGrigio350x25{ width:350px; height:25px; border:1px solid #D1D1D1;font-family:Arial, Helvetica, sans-serif; color:#1E5E8F; font-size:12px;  padding-top:5px;padding-left:2px; margin-right:10px}
.formGrigio350x25:focus{ border:2px solid #1E5E8F;height:23px;}

.formGrigio200x20{ width:200px; height:20px; border:1px solid #D1D1D1;font-family:Arial, Helvetica, sans-serif; color:#1E5E8F; font-size:12px;  padding-top:1px;padding-left:2px; margin-right:10px}
.formGrigio200x20:focus{ border:2px solid #1E5E8F;height:18px;width:198px; background-color:#FFFFF0}

.formGrigioSelect200x20{ width:200px; height:22px; border:1px solid #D1D1D1;font-family:Arial, Helvetica, sans-serif; color:#1E5E8F; font-size:12px;  padding-top:1px;padding-left:2px; margin-right:10px}
.formGrigioSelect200x20:focus{ border:2px solid #1E5E8F;height:22px;width:198px; background-color:#FFFFF0}

.formGrigio224x25{ width:224px; height:25px; border:1px solid #D1D1D1;font-family:Arial, Helvetica, sans-serif; color:#1E5E8F; font-size:12px;  padding-top:1px;padding-left:2px; margin-right:10px}
.formGrigio224x25:focus{background-color:#FFFFF0}

.formGrigioSelect224x25{ width:224px; height:27px; border:1px solid #D1D1D1;font-family:Arial, Helvetica, sans-serif; color:#1E5E8F; font-size:12px;  padding-top:1px;padding-left:2px; margin-right:10px}
.formGrigioSelect224x25:focus{background-color:#FFFFF0}


.formGrigio200x40{ width:200px; height:25px; border:1px solid #D1D1D1;font-family:Arial, Helvetica, sans-serif; color:#1E5E8F; font-size:12px;  padding-top:1px;padding-left:2px; margin-right:10px}
.formGrigio200x40:focus{background-color:#FFFFF0}

.formGrigio520x120{ width:520px; height:120px; border:1px solid #D1D1D1;font-family:Arial, Helvetica, sans-serif; color:#1E5E8F; font-size:12px;  padding-top:5px;padding-left:2px; margin-right:10px}
.formGrigio520x120:focus{ border:2px solid #1E5E8F; height:118px;}

.formGrigio40x18{ border:1px solid #333; width:40px; height:18px}
.formGrigio100x18{ border:1px solid #333; width:100px; height:18px}
.boxVerdeTips{ border:1px solid #008000; background-color:#D5FFD5; padding:6px; font-size:11px }
.boxVerdeTips a,.boxVerdeTips a:active,.boxVerdeTips a:visited{ color:#333}
p.headerActionGrey{ background-color:#333; color:#FFF; font-family:Georgia, "Times New Roman", Times, serif; font-size:12px; padding:5px; padding-left:5px;}

a.dp-choose-date {
	float: left;
	width: 16px;
	
	padding: 0;
	margin: 5px 0px 0;
	display: block;
	text-indent: -2000px;
	overflow: hidden;
	background: url(../img/calendar.png) no-repeat; 
}
a.dp-choose-date.dp-disabled {
	background-position: 0 -20px;
	cursor: default;
}



.txtRossoArial11{font-family: Arial, Helvetica, sans-serif;color:#F00; font-size:11px; font-weight:normal  }
.txtGrigioArial11{font-family: Arial, Helvetica, sans-serif;color:#666; font-size:11px; font-weight:normal  }
.txtGrigioScuroArial11{font-family: Arial, Helvetica, sans-serif;color:#333; font-size:11px; font-weight:normal  }
.txtGrigioArial12{font-family: Arial, Helvetica, sans-serif;color:#666; font-size:13px; font-weight:normal  }
.txtGrigioScuroArial12{font-family: Arial, Helvetica, sans-serif;color:#333; font-size:13px; font-weight:normal  }
.txtBiancoArial11Bold{ font-family:Arial, Helvetica, sans-serif; color:#FFF; font-size:11px; font-weight:bold; }
.txtBiancoArial11{ font-family:Arial, Helvetica, sans-serif; color:#FFF; font-size:11px; font-weight:normal; }
.txtBlueArial10{ font-family:Arial, Helvetica, sans-serif; color:#1E5E8F; font-size:10px;}
.txtBlueArial11{font-family:Arial, Helvetica, sans-serif; color:#1E5E8F; font-size:11px; font-weight:normal}
.txtBlueArial11Bold{ font-family:Arial, Helvetica, sans-serif; color:#1E5E8F; font-size:11px; font-weight:bold; }
.txtBlueArial12Bold{ font-family:Arial, Helvetica, sans-serif; color:#1E5E8F; font-size:12px; font-weight:bold; }
.txtNeroArial11{ font-family:Arial, Helvetica, sans-serif;color:#000; font-size:11px; font-weight:normal; }
.txtBlueArial0-75{font-family:Arial, Helvetica, sans-serif; font-size:12px;color:#1E5E8F;}
.txtBlueGeorgia11{ font-family:Georgia, "Times New Roman", Times, serif;color:#1E5E8F; font-size:11px; font-weight:normal; }
.txtBlueGeorgia12{ font-family:Georgia, "Times New Roman", Times, serif;color:#1E5E8F; font-size:12px; font-weight:normal; }
.txtBlueGeorgia13{ font-family:Georgia, "Times New Roman", Times, serif;color:#1E5E8F; font-size:13px; font-weight:normal; }
.txtBlueGeorgia14{ font-family:Georgia, "Times New Roman", Times, serif;color:#1E5E8F; font-size:14px; font-weight:normal; }
.txtBlueGeorgia12Undelined{ font-family:Georgia, "Times New Roman", Times, serif;color:#1E5E8F; font-size:12px; font-weight:normal; text-decoration:underline }
.txtBlueGeorgia10{ font-family:Georgia, "Times New Roman", Times, serif;color:#1E5E8F; font-size:12px; font-weight:normal; }
.txtBlueVerdana10{ font-family:Verdana, Geneva, sans-serif;color:#1E5E8F; font-size:10px; font-weight:normal; }
.txtBlueGeorgia11{ font-family:Georgia, "Times New Roman", Times, serif;color:#1E5E8F; font-size:11px; font-weight:normal; }
.txtBlueGeorgia12Bold{ font-family:Georgia, "Times New Roman", Times, serif;color:#1E5E8F; font-size:12px; font-weight:bold; }
.txtBlueGeorgia13Bold{ font-family:Georgia, "Times New Roman", Times, serif;color:#1E5E8F; font-size:13px; font-weight:bold; }
.txtBlueGeorgia15Bold{ font-family:Georgia, "Times New Roman", Times, serif;color:#1E5E8F; font-size:15px; font-weight:bold; }
.txtOrangeGeorgia15Bold{ font-family:Georgia, "Times New Roman", Times, serif;color:#F15A23; font-size:15px; font-weight:bold; }
.txtBlueGeorgia18Bold{ font-family:Georgia, "Times New Roman", Times, serif;color:#1E5E8F; font-size:18px; font-weight:bold;}
.txtBlueGeorgia20Bold{ font-family:Georgia, "Times New Roman", Times, serif;color:#1E5E8F; font-size:20px; font-weight:bold;}
.txtBlueGeorgia14{ font-family:Georgia, "Times New Roman", Times, serif;color:#1E5E8F; font-size:14px; font-weight:normal; }
.txtBlueGeorgia16{ font-family:Georgia, "Times New Roman", Times, serif;color:#1E5E8F; font-size:16px; font-weight:normal; }
.txtBlueGeorgia18Bold{ font-family:Georgia, "Times New Roman", Times, serif;color:#1E5E8F; font-size:18px; font-weight:bold; }
.txtBlueChiaroGeorgia13{font-family:Georgia, "Times New Roman", Times, serif;color:#1172A4; font-size:13px; font-weight:normal;}
.txtBlueChiaroGeorgia13Bold{font-family:Georgia, "Times New Roman", Times, serif;color:#1172A4; font-size:13px; font-weight:bold;}
.txtGrigioGeorgia11{font-family:Georgia, "Times New Roman", Times, serif;color:#666; font-size:11px; font-weight:normal  }
.txtGrigioGeorgia12{font-family:Georgia, "Times New Roman", Times, serif;color:#666; font-size:12px;  }
.txtGrigioGeorgia14{font-family:Georgia, "Times New Roman", Times, serif;color:#666; font-size:14px; font-weight:normal  }
.txtGrigioGeorgia17{font-family:Georgia, "Times New Roman", Times, serif;color:#666; font-size:17px; font-weight:normal  }
.txtGrigioGeorgia12Bold{font-family:Georgia, "Times New Roman", Times, serif;color:#666; font-size:12px; font-weight:bold  }
.txtGrigioScuroVerdana10{ font-family:Verdana, Geneva, sans-serif;color:#333; font-size:10px; font-weight:normal; }
.txtGrigioScuroGeorgia11Bold{font-family:Georgia, "Times New Roman", Times, serif;color:#333; font-size:11px; font-weight:bold  }
.txtGrigioScuroGeorgia11{font-family:Georgia, "Times New Roman", Times, serif;color:#333; font-size:11px; font-weight:normal  }
.txtGrigioScuroGeorgia12{font-family:Georgia, "Times New Roman", Times, serif;color:#333; font-size:12px; font-weight:normal }
.txtGrigioScuroGeorgia12Bold{font-family:Georgia, "Times New Roman", Times, serif;color:#333; font-size:12px; font-weight:bold  }
.txtGrigioScuroGeorgia12Underlined{font-family:Georgia, "Times New Roman", Times, serif;color:#333; font-size:12px; font-weight:normal; text-decoration:underline }
.txtGrigioScuroGeorgia13{font-family:Georgia, "Times New Roman", Times, serif;color:#333; font-size:13px; font-weight:normal }
.txtGrigioScuroGeorgia14{font-family:Georgia, "Times New Roman", Times, serif;color:#333; font-size:14px; font-weight:normal }
.txtGrigioScuroGeorgia16{font-family:Georgia, "Times New Roman", Times, serif;color:#333; font-size:16px; font-weight:normal }
.txtGrigioScuroGeorgia16Underlined{font-family:Georgia, "Times New Roman", Times, serif;color:#333; font-size:16px; font-weight:normal; text-decoration:underline }
.txtBiancoArial0-65{font-family:Arial, Helvetica, sans-serif;color:#FFF; font-size:0.70em; font-weight:normal;}
.txtBiancoGeorgia10{font-family:Georgia, "Times New Roman", Times, serif;color:#FFF; font-size:10px; font-weight:normal;  }
.txtBiancoGeorgia12Bold{font-family:Georgia, "Times New Roman", Times, serif;color:#FFF; font-size:12px; font-weight:bold;  }
.txtBiancoGeorgia13Bold{font-family:Georgia, "Times New Roman", Times, serif;color:#FFF; font-size:13px; font-weight:bold;  }
.txtBiancoGeorgia12{font-family:Georgia, "Times New Roman", Times, serif;color:#FFF; font-size:12px; font-weight:normal;  }
.txtBiancoGeorgia14{font-family:Georgia, "Times New Roman", Times, serif;color:#FFF; font-size:14px; font-weight:normal;  }
.txtBiancoGeorgia14Underlined{font-family:Georgia, "Times New Roman", Times, serif;color:#FFF; font-size:14px; font-weight:bold; text-decoration:underline  }
.txtBiancoGeorgia16Underlined{font-family:Georgia, "Times New Roman", Times, serif;color:#FFF; font-size:16px; font-weight:normal; text-decoration:underline  }
.txtBiancoGeorgia15Bold{font-family:Georgia, "Times New Roman", Times, serif;color:#FFF; font-size:15px; font-weight:bold;  }
.txtNeroGeorgia11{ font-family:Georgia, "Times New Roman", Times, serif;color:#000; font-size:11px; font-weight:normal; }
.txtNeroGeorgia12{ font-family:Georgia, "Times New Roman", Times, serif;color:#000; font-size:12px; font-weight:normal; }
.txtNeroGeorgia14{ font-family:Georgia, "Times New Roman", Times, serif;color:#000; font-size:14px; font-weight:normal; }
.txtNeroGeorgia16{ font-family:Georgia, "Times New Roman", Times, serif;color:#000; font-size:16px; font-weight:normal; }
.txtNeroGeorgia12Bold{ font-family:Georgia, "Times New Roman", Times, serif;color:#000; font-size:12px; font-weight:bold; }
.txtNeroGeorgia12Underlined{ font-family:Georgia, "Times New Roman", Times, serif;color:#000; font-size:12px; font-weight:normal; text-decoration:underline }
.txtNeroGeorgia16Underlined{ font-family:Georgia, "Times New Roman", Times, serif;color:#000; font-size:16px; font-weight:normal; text-decoration:underline }
.txtRossoGeorgia12{font-family:Georgia, "Times New Roman", Times, serif;color:#F00; font-size:12px; font-weight:normal }
.txtRossoGeorgia15{font-family:Georgia, "Times New Roman", Times, serif;color:#F00; font-size:15px; font-weight:normal }
.txtRossoGeorgia20{font-family:Georgia, "Times New Roman", Times, serif;color:#F00; font-size:20px; font-weight:normal }
.txtNeroArial0-65{font-family:Arial, Helvetica, sans-serif; font-size:10px; color:#000}
.numeriClassifica{ width:15px; height:13px; background:url(../img/nLibri.jpg) no-repeat;font-family:Arial, Helvetica, sans-serif; color:#FFF; font-size:11px; font-weight:bold; padding-left:4px;  padding-right:2px; float:left; margin-right:2px;padding-bottom:20px; margin-top:2px}

.categoriaNews{ margin-right:2px; margin-bottom:5px; background-color:#FFFFCE;font-family:Georgia, "Times New Roman", Times, serif;color:#666; font-size:10px; font-weight:bold; }

.margin5Top{ margin-top:5px}
.margin5Bottom{ margin-bottom:5px}
.margin5Left{ margin-left:5px}
.margin5Right{ margin-right:5px}



	  .paginate {
font-family: Arial, Helvetica, sans-serif;
font-size: .7em;
}
a.paginate {
border: 1px solid #1E5E8F;
padding: 2px 6px 2px 6px;
text-decoration: none;
color: #1E5E8F;
}
a.paginate:hover {
background-color: #1E5E8F;
color: #FFF;
text-decoration: underline;
}
a.current {
border: 1px solid #1E5E8F;
font: bold .7em Arial,Helvetica,sans-serif;
padding: 2px 6px 2px 6px;
cursor: default;
background:#1E5E8F;
color: #FFF;
text-decoration: none;
}
span.inactive {
border: 1px solid #999;
font-family: Arial, Helvetica, sans-serif;
font-size: .7em;
padding: 2px 6px 2px 6px;
color: #999;
cursor: default;
}

